Ophicephalidae

plural noun
Ophi·​ce·​phal·​i·​dae | \ ˌäfəsə̇ˈfaləˌdē, ˌōf-\

Definition of Ophicephalidae

: a family of elongated cylindrical carnivorous labyrinth fishes comprising the snakehead mullets of eastern Asia and Africa and usually made coextensive with a suborder of Percomorphi

History and Etymology for Ophicephalidae

New Latin, from Ophicephalus, type genus (from ophi- + -cephalus) + -idae
